Presentation: Evolutionary Architecture: From Start-Up to Scale-Up

  • Presented by: David Santoro, CTO & Co-founder, Carwow
  • Location: Westminster, 4th flr.
  • Time: 4:10PM-5:00PM
  • ABSTRACT: Many young startup CTOs think that they need to create the perfect architecture from day one. Spending many hours creating the ideal microservice architecture before having market fit, and spending days customising infrastructure and deployments instead of using PaaS like Heroku could be the death of your startup. David Santoro, CTO & co-founder of Carwow, will share some of the principles and tricks he has used to evolve Carwow’s architecture from a three-person company run from a kitchen table to a 250-person scale up with a presence in three countries; no “platform rewrite” needed.

Presentation: Stories from the BeeHive

  • Presented by: Jonathan Lister Parsons, Software Developer, PensionBee
  • Location: Westminster, 4th flr.
  • Time: 11:50AM-12:40pm
  • ABSTRACT: PensionBee is the UK's most loved pension company. Starting in 2015, PensionBee has helped over 70,000 customers manage close to £1bn of their pension savings. In this enjoyable talk, PensionBee CTO Jonathan Lister Parsons digs into the challenges of growing a consumer-focused fintech company in an outdated industry. Through a series of "Stories from the BeeHive," he shows how technology and people come together to create a culture of "Happiness!" that leads to positive effects both inside and outside the organisation. Learn how PensionBee is getting the most from technologies like Heroku to provide excellent customer service, do more with less, and create meaningful career progression for the team.
